Web26 de mar. de 2016 · Op amps are often used as unity gain amplifiers to isolate stages of a circuit from one another. Unity gain amplifiers come in two types: voltage followers and voltage inverters. The circuit is named a trigger because the output retains its value until the input changes … how has water shaped earth\u0027s surfaceWebThe following figure shows the inverting adder using op-amp with two inputs V1 and V2. Let us assume currents I1 and I2 are flowing through resistances R1 and R2 respectively. Since input current to the op-amp is zero, the two currents are added to get current I, which flows through the feedback resistance Rf.
